Solve the all parts of following problem given below:
Problem: A truck is towing a 1200-kg car on a horizontal road with a chain. The chain makes a 15o angle above the horizontal as it pulls on the car. (Neglect any frictional effects in this problem.) The car is being accelerated at 0.57 m/s2 by the chain.
Part A: What is the tension in the chain? (Hint: Draw a good FBD and apply Newton's 2nd law to the x-direction. There should be three forces shown on your FBD!)
Part B: What is the car's apparent weight as it is being towed with the acceleration given above?
